  • Blackberry desktop software and itunes music sync problem

    Ok so I have a Blackberry Torch 9800, OS 6.0 and the current blackberry desktop softer version 6.1.0.35.
    I was previously able to access all my itunes music and playlists via the desktop software. But since I completed the software updates not all my music is loading into the software and none of my playlists are showing up.
    I'm not sure if this is related but I believe that twice my phone has rebooted itself. I've also noticed that the new desktop software has had issues detecting my phone. My main concern is the problem with the music sync issue.
    In the interim I have just dragged and dropped music files onto my memory card. Can you please let me know what I can do to fix this if anything....thanks.

    I just experienced the same thing and after feeling frustrated for about an hour and wishing I'd learn my lesson and stop upgrading software for no reason, I went into the Desktop Manager software Device Settings.
    Under Device Settingsgo to the Media tab and you'll see a Music Source option. I found that my default setting was on Windows Media Player instead of iTunes. Once I switched it back my view refreshed and my playlists showed up again.

  • I upgraded from an android to an new iphone 4s. I have an itunes account and library but I am reluctant to connect my phone to my computer in fear of all of my itunes music syncing to my new phone.

    Is it possible to choose which songs from my itunes library to add to my phone?  Also, my pictures are stored on my computer but not my itunes library, can I pick and choose which pictures to upload to my new iphone 4s?  Any help/advice would be appreciated.  Thanks

    Under the Music t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es, you have the option to transfer your entire music library or selected playlists, artists, genres, albums.
    iTunes does not store photos. iTunes serves as the transfer conduit to transfer photos from your computer to your iPhone, which is selected under the Photos t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es.
    If you manually manage photo storage on your computer, create a folder on your computer to place the named folder of photos you want transferred to your iPhone. Select the parent folder under the Photos t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es followed by a sync.

  • ITunes music sync problems (clouds and dotted circles)

    I think this is a common problem but I tried several solutions I found online and nothing seems to work.
    When I connect my iPhone to iTunes I have several songs on it that have a dotted circle and that are in grey font. These songs are mostly from an album I purchased some time ago and then removed from my iTunes library since I did not want to hear it anymore.
    I would like to get those phones off my phone. I tried to uncheck the "sync music" box and made a sync but this did not work. I also tried to remove all songs from my iphone using the storage management settings but this did not work as well. On a related note, there are several songs that show up on my phone and that have a little cloud next to them. These songs do not show up in iTunes when I connect the phone.
    So in summary: My iPhone shows songs (with a cloud) that I do not see in iTunes when I check what is supposed to be on my phone. And what I see in iTunes (the songs with the dotted circle) do not seem to be on my iPhone.
    This is driving me crazy. Any suggestions anyone?

    The songs with the cloud symbol don't appear in iTunes because they aren't on your phone.  Those are links to your previously purchased music in the iTunes store so you can easily download them by tapping the symbol. 
    If you want help with the "dotted circle" issue you should post this question over in the iTunes forum.  The only thing I can suggest is to delete all your music (by going to Settings>General>Usage>Manage Storage>Music, tap Edit, then tap next to All Songs), then sync it back using iTunes.  If you already tried that unsuccessfully, try posting over in the iTunes forum.

  • ITunes 9 and iPhone 3.1 - music sync prob (artists not all shown)

    Hello,
    I'v updated to iTunes 9 und iPhone OS 3.1, went ok.
    Most sync with iPhone did well, but in the music sync window not all of my artists show up. I compared and can not find a difference between tracks to artist that show up and others that do'nt (mp3, ID-Tag version 2.3,...).
    Does anyone experience the same and/or has a solution to this?
    H.

    Hello,
    in the case where I can see the artist, album-artist is empty. So I tried to empty the album-artist in the not-visible case too. Result: now it was visible
    Because there are artist-entries for sorting too, I tried this:
    album-artist filled, but sorting-album-artist empty => it is not visible
    album-artist empty, but sorting-album-artist filled =>
    ergo:
    1) there is a way to get these visible: leave the album-artist-fields empty !! (may use the sorting-album-artist-field at least)
    2) the visibility of entries in the sync-list should not depend on the filling of the album-artist-fields
    => This should be fixed in the next update...

  • How do i stop itunes from syncing all my music to iphone

    I have a problem where I have all my music syncing on to my iPhone even when "sync music" is unchecked in the iTunes application.
    The data bar at the bottom of the screen shows that the sync worked (increased data amounts become available) but the music is still on the iphone.
    I have even deleted music off my laptop but it still shows on the iPhone.
    I've read the discussions on similar issues but can't seem to find a remedy. I discovered this problem when I needed to create some free space on the phone to add an app update. I decided to just keep my Top Rated music on the phone but as I say, everything is still there. The sync's seem to work.
    Any ideas please. I've spent a fair amount of time already on this.
    I am using ms notebook. iphone 5 with latest software (iOS 8.1.3).
    Hope someone has some ideas. Thanks.

    Hello phil.winter,
    Welcome to the Apple Support Communities!
    I understand that you would like to remove your music from your iPhone but are thus far unsuccessful. I know that you have already unchecked the Sync Music box and report that the music remained on your iPhone, but did you click the Apply button in the bottom right hand corner of iTunes after you unchecked that box? If not please try this step and let me know if the issue continues. 
    Sync your iPhone, iPad, and iPod with iTunes using USB - Apple Support
    Click the Sync button in the lower-right corner of the screen to sync your content. Only the information in the content list you've enabled syncing for will sync to your computer. If you made any changes to any of the settings, first click the apply button.
